Output 75cb3ba1236ccb96914991ef55bfc53b1e97ede15459f15b4fb3beff7daf42ee:0

value
271296
script pubkey
OP_0 OP_PUSHBYTES_20 a2f21882e83b6a1826142f2a42a758bfa21d8f04
address
bc1q5tep3qhg8d4psfs59u4y9f6ch73pmrcyjxvq22
transaction
75cb3ba1236ccb96914991ef55bfc53b1e97ede15459f15b4fb3beff7daf42ee
confirmations
56943
spent
true